....Recent discovery about the amps: After the third amp arrived "DOA", I decided to check into things a bit further. It turns out the first one may have overheated, but in the removal/installation of the later ones, I must have tweaked the ground cable enough so that it wouldn't provide a solid connection to the chassis. It was tight just enough to throw me off in troubleshooting and show continuity, but when I relocated it and used better hardware to secure it, the amp worked fine. So my conclusion is that the second and third amp worked fine, I just wrongly accused Infinity of DOA products! I wouldn't hesitate to recommend another Kappa5 knowing what I do now.
